Insider reveals Samsung considering lowering memory chip prices

Samsung Electronics is considering lowering the price of its memory chips in the second half of 2022, aiming to further expand its market share, according to industry sources cited by the media. If Samsung decides to cut prices, other memory chip companies will follow suit and spark a price war in the second half of this year, the sources said.


Micron previously sharply lowered its earnings target in its fiscal fourth-quarter outlook. Micron Chief Executive Officer Sanjay Mehrotra said that weak end demand in the consumer market, including personal computers (PCs) and smartphones, is significantly dragging down demand in the global memory industry.


Micron said that end demand in the consumer market as well as in the data center sector is weak and some enterprise OEM customers intend to reduce their memory inventories.

According to the latest research by TrendForce, despite the rapid weakening of overall consumer demand in the first half of this year, the previous strong bargaining power of DRAM OEMs did not show signs of price cuts for sales, causing inventory pressure to gradually shift from the buyer to the seller side.


According to TrendForce, in the second half of the year, when demand is uncertain, some DRAM suppliers have already started to have clear intentions to reduce prices, especially in the server sector where demand is relatively stable, in order to de-stabilize inventory pressure. If the subsequent situation triggers the original manufacturers to bid down the price to sell, the drop may exceed 10%.
